Description
Photograph of an exterior view of Soldiers' Home Hospital, 1923. A road lies across the foreground while small signs stand in the grass yard behind it. A path leads through the grass to the large, lightly-colored hospital at center. The hospital has a long porch across its front wall and awnings over its many windows. Large palm trees stand over either side where other houses stand along the street.
